The realistic sky type now supports stars in Wicked Engine. Stars can be configured with a simple slider that modifies the amount of stars. The stars will rotate with the sun, to have the illusion of the planet rotation. This effect is fake, achieved with gradient noise in the pixel shader.

The old CPU particle system has been replaced with a GPU-based system. This allows for an increased scale in simulation, additional collision with scene geometry. New effects are available with the help of force fields and particle motion blur.
